The Eurofins Agroscience Group is one of Europe's leading service companies. We conduct field and laboratory studies to determine the safety of new substances and organisms for humans and the environment, as well as their efficacy. We are experts in conducting global field studies according to GEP and GLP, worker exposure studies, ecotoxicology, product chemistry, testing of physico-chemical properties, and environmental fate studies.

Additionally, we support our clients at every stage of the registration process. Our in-house team of regulatory experts works with our network of field stations, laboratories, and carefully selected partners.

Eurofins Agroscience Services EcoChem GmbH is part of the group and offers analytical studies to support the testing, development, and registration of test substances worldwide.

Environmental Fate & Metabolism:

• ​​​​​​14C-labeled environmental fate studies in water, soil, and air
• Metabolism studies in plants and animals
• Leaching, persistence, and bioaccumulation studies

In just 35 years, Eurofins has grown from one laboratory in Nantes, France, to over 63.000 employees in a network of more than 900 independent companies in over 60 countries with more than 950 laboratories. Eurofins offers a portfolio of more than 200,000 analytical methods to assess the safety, identity, composition, authenticity, origin, traceability and purity of biological substances and products as well as innovative clinical diagnostic services as one of the world's leading emerging providers of specialized clinical diagnostic tests.   

In 2024 , Eurofins generated total revenues of EUR 6,95 billion, and has been among the best performing stocks in Europe over the past 20 years.
